<div dir="ltr"><div>Following idr's suggestion I limited the scope of my GSoC project to just the functionality of GL_EXT_direct_state_access that isn't removed in OpenGL 3.1+, so the extension is only advertised in core contexts.<br>

<br></div><div>It seems like the series is way too big to just send to the list immediately, but it's available on github in the 'direct_state_access' branch:<br><br><a href="https://github.com/nobled/mesa.git">https://github.com/nobled/mesa.git</a><br>

</div><div><br><div>It includes some functionality of 
GL_ARB_separate_shader_objects (the ProgramUniform* entrypoints), so the
 work on that extension that's been going on might need rebasing if this 
goes in first.<br></div><div><br></div></div><div>I'm still working on piglit tests for this series.<br></div></div>